Performance review tips for employees: Making the next one count


Effective employee reviews are incredibly important in any business organization. They also offer an opportunity for employers to set clear expectations, as well as give employees a setting to explore any concerns. Additionally, employee reviews can provide a valuable opportunity for employers and HR personnel to spend one-on-one time with their staff. The problem is, performance management can sometimes be a stressful experience and even a waste of time for all the parties involved.

In order to make sure your employee reviews run smoothly and effectively, guest author Johanna Cider offers some helpful performance management tips to keep in mind. Conducting your first performance review? Rewards and promotions, in general, can go a long way, so think carefully about what would motivate each individual employee. Then you can offer work-related rewards based on their personalities and interests.

Instead, you should be giving your staff a chance to have their say about their own performance and engagement. At the end of the employee review, you could also ask for their personal opinion on projects or company policies. The worst kinds of performance reviews are the ones that leave employees scratching their heads. Instead, you should make sure that you have examples to back up your points.

Therefore, any criticism you give your employees should be constructive. Indeed, with employees reporting lower empowerment and engagement within the workplace, your employees need to walk out of their performance review feeling like they have the capabilities and support to improve. For example, if you have a team member who often misses deadlines, make a plan to structure their working week so that they can start meeting important targets.

Indeed, goal-setting can be a great way for employees to feel more positive and enthusiastic about their jobs in the long-run. Of course, the goals for each employee will depend on their job, but planning them alongside HR will ensure that employees take them more seriously. Choose a platform and set up miniature rewards for each employee as they reach certain targets. When an entire team has met its goals, treat everyone to something special. This way, employees will leave the room feeling appreciated, even if they do need to improve in some areas.

To make things run as smoothly as possible, always let your employees know about their performance review in advance so they can prepare. Remember, the ultimate goal is setting the stage for an open and honest conversation about employee performance. Like most employees, you want to do well in your job. In order to do that, you need a clear understanding of what is expected of you. You may also need support and training to meet those expectations. Good performance management is a continuous, positive collaboration between you and your supervisor. By staying connected with your supervisor all year round, you can make adjustments to your work performance as needed, and your supervisor can assess and support your performance and ability to meet your annual goals. You and your supervisor should have a discussion about your work goals for the upcoming year. You should expect to have this discussion around the time of your annual performance review for the previous year.

Employee engagement company TINYPulse surveyed over one thousand professionals and discovered that 37 percent think the process is outdated, and 42 percent feel that managers leave important elements out of their reviews due to bias. Nearly a quarter said they feared performance reviews, and the trend was especially strong among millennials, who also said the process stressed them out. Although face-to-face feedback on a regular basis is an important tool for encouraging and motivating your team, the written review gives both the employee and manager something concrete to refer to.
